對自定義結構慎用sizeof;最近的讀書體會;

問題提出:

        使用ZeroMemory()時,調試提示內存溢出;

        原因:自定義的純數據結構中使用了string變量,而用sizeof()不能確定實際此結構變量的大小,導致內存溢出

        總結:對於自定義的純數據結構,一定不用CString,string等類變量,以免sizeof()這種情況的出錯;

讀書體會:

        前一陣對自己提出了兼顧廣度和深度的要求,在具體實施上現在有了一想法,把她記下來:

        深度方面:往網絡方向發展;我對硬作尤其是電子方面的不感興趣,同時網絡應用方面對數學的要求不是很高,我覺得可以往裏鑽;

        廣度方面:一是設計模式,上一個月買到了一本好書:Martin的《敏捷軟件開發:原則、模式與實踐》。現在讀第一遍,已看了一半,很多地方讓我心裏有共鳴的感覺;另外也買了一本《面向對象分析和設計》還沒細看,覺得作者站在了較高的高度;二是管理知識,上一個月也買了德魯克的《旁觀者》;三是自己的人際交往方面還相當薄弱,讓我很着急。

買書計劃:

        網絡方面的;軟件項目管理方面的;健康方面的;自我綜合能力提高方面的;

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章